User Story
As a user I want to be able to add my oracle cloud account as a source to cost management and see cost data reflected in the UI.
Prioritization / Business Case
This is a new source type for HCS
Impacts
- API
- Data Engineering
- Database
- Docs
- UI
- UX
External Dependencies
Platform sources needs to add OCI to enable it for cost management
UX/UI Requirements
Is completion of a design/mock a prerequisite to working this epic or can portions be done concurrently?
- This can be worked in parallel but will require all new UI pages specifically for OCI
Documentation Requirements
What documentation is required to complete this epic?
- Account/Source creation setup guide
Backend Requirements
- API work
API Side
- Query handler
- Tag query handler
- Provider map
- Serializers
- API endpoints
- Report endpoints
- Cost
- Instance type
- Storage
- Tags
- Resource-types
- Forecasts
- Report endpoints
- Currency support
- Cost-model updates to add markup costs
QE Requirements
Does QE need specific data or tooling to successfully test this epic?
- Nise will need to be updated to give QE advanced data scenarios for testing
Release Criteria
Can this epic be released as individual issues/tasks are completed? Y
Can the backend be released without the frontend? Y
Has QE approved this epic?
- is blocked by
-
COST-2450 Oracle Cloud Infrastructure Cost Management data ingestion
- Closed
- relates to
-
COST-2945 Docs: Oracle Cloud Infrastructure API/UI for Cost Management
- Closed
-
COST-2993 OCI cache not invalidated - local testing issue
- Closed
-
COST-3217 First of the month issue - OCI previous month's data not ingested locally
- Closed
-
COST-3409 Delta percent is null in daily OCI storage delta reports
- Closed